In the exam room, Iris lay listening to the fast, steady thump of the fetal heartbeat on the monitor. Tears soaked quietly into the pillow beneath her head.

Hold on, little one.

The doctor’s voice was gentle. “Try to stay calm. Baby’s heartbeat is strong. But your stress levels are affecting both of you-you need rest now.”

“Doctor…” Iris’ voice trembled. “Will the baby be all right?”

The doctor sighed softly. “We’ll have to monitor you. For now, focus on staying relaxed. We’ll take it hour by hour.”

An hour later, the exam room door opened.

Julian was there in an instant. “How is she?”

“Stable for now, but we need to keep her for observation-at least forty-eight hours,” the doctor said firmly. “Maternal stress directly impacts the fetus. She can’t handle any more upheaval.”

Julian nodded and hurried inside.

Iris was propped up against the raised bed. When she heard him enter, she turned her face toward the window.

He walked over and sat on the edge of the bed, reaching for her hand.

But the moment his fingers brushed hers, Iris pulled away coldly. She bit back the hurt rising in her throat and kept her watery gaze fixed outside.

Julian bowed his head. “I’m sorry, Iris,” he said, the words thick with regret.

Iris didn’t answer.

Outside, spring leaves rustled softly in a gentle breeze, sunlight filtering through the branches.

The hospital room was still, almost too quiet.

Julian leaned back in the chair, shoulders slumped as if carrying something too heavy to bear. He rested his arms on his knees, watching her profile in silence.

His eyes held a raw pain, the kind that comes from knowing the person in front of you-and the future you’re hoping for-could slip away any moment.

A long stretch of quiet passed.
